News24 | EU to hold urgent Ukraine talks before Trump-Putin meeting
Monday, 11 August 2025 () EU foreign ministers will hold an emergency meeting on Monday to discuss the looming summit between presidents Vladimir Putin and Donald Trump, as Europe fears any deal made without Ukraine could force unacceptable compromises.
